Gambling in Atlantic City

Gambling in Atlantic City, initially made legal in Nineteen Seventy Eight, has given a tremendous boost to the economy. As a result, Atlantic City has now become a dominant tourist destination, with millions and millions of visitors each year, spending billions of dollars for pleasure.

When you think of gambling in Atlantic City, you will most likely to think ‘Poker’. Over 50 million people compete in poker at least once every four weeks and Atlantic City offers some of the very best casino poker rooms in the state.Just about all of the above-mentioned casinos are situated by the Boardwalk and in the Marina area. The Sands, Bally’s, and Harrah’s are relatively small in comparison to a few of the other gambling casinos, but they provide many low-limit poker games and daily tournaments in Texas Hold’Em, 5-Card Stud, and Omaha/8 poker.

The poker rooms at the Sands, Bally’s Wild Wild West, and many of the other casinos provide a substantial number of no-smoking games for patrons. The Tropicana has sporting events on TV that are viewable from each and every table. The Tropicana also has the Trop Poker Club, open 24/7, in which its members can acquire anywhere from $0.50 to $2.00 an hour for every live poker game they play. This cash can be spent on room, food, or beverages and are just another incentive to gamble on poker.

Playing in Atlantic City is frequently closely identified with the incredibly popular Trump Taj Majal, which introduced the first no-smoking poker room. It features more than 70 tables, where you can participate in many kinds of poker, including 7-Card Stud, Texas Hold-em, and Omaha hi-low, for a very low entry of $1 up to $600. Daily tournaments, hi/lo poker games, and two annual tournaments, including the U.S. Poker Championship and the Trump Classic. The Taj Majal, as well as many other casinos, provide gratis poker classes for the newcomer. If you are gambling in Atlantic City and looking for opulence and elegance, you must think about Caesar’s, and the Borgata Hotel Casino and Spa.
